LocationBirmingham, Bristol, Leeds, Newcastle-upon-Tyne, Nottingham, Oldham, SwanseaAbout the jobJob summaryThe DVSA are continuing to strengthen security capability across the business. This role will form a part of a growing Cyber function continuing to embed and maintain an assurance and response